  • What is the name of Turin’s airport?

    Turin is served by Turin Citta Di Torino Airport, also commonly referred to as Citta Di Torino, Sandro Pertini, Turin, Turin Caselle, or Turin-Caselle. The airport code is TRN.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ights to Turin?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Turin with an airline and back with another airline.
